Black Bean-Tomato Salsa

Recipe #244599 | 1½ hours | 20 min prep | add private note
Caroline Cooks

By: Caroline Cooks
Aug 6, 2007

The measurements are optional to your taste. I usually just dump and taste and dump and taste. LOL Good with crab or tuna cakes or with tortilla chips. The yield is approximate.

3 -4 cups (change servings and units)

Ingredients

Directions

  1. 1
    Mix all ingredients.
  2. 2
    Taste and adjust seasoning.
  3. 3
    Refrigerate at least one hour to meld flavors.
